ACPI: bay: Convert ACPI Bay driver to be compatible with sysfs update.
authorZhang Rui <rui.zhang@intel.com>
Thu, 11 Jan 2007 07:09:09 +0000 (02:09 -0500)
committerLen Brown <len.brown@intel.com>
Sat, 3 Feb 2007 06:14:56 +0000 (01:14 -0500)
Set fake hid for ejectable drive bay.
Match bay devices by checking the hid.
Remove .match method of Bay driver.

+/*
+ * acpi_bay_match - see if a device is an ejectable driver bay
+ *
+ * If an acpi object is ejectable and has one of the ACPI ATA methods defined,
+ * then we can safely call it an ejectable drive bay
+ */
+static int acpi_bay_match(struct acpi_device *device){
+       acpi_status status;
+       acpi_handle handle;
+       acpi_handle tmp;
+       acpi_handle phandle;
+
+       handle = device->handle;
+
+       status = acpi_get_handle(handle, "_EJ0", &tmp);
+       if (ACPI_FAILURE(status))
+               return -ENODEV;
+
+       if ((ACPI_SUCCESS(acpi_get_handle(handle, "_GTF", &tmp))) ||
+               (ACPI_SUCCESS(acpi_get_handle(handle, "_GTM", &tmp))) ||
+               (ACPI_SUCCESS(acpi_get_handle(handle, "_STM", &tmp))) ||
+               (ACPI_SUCCESS(acpi_get_handle(handle, "_SDD", &tmp))))
+               return 0;
+
+       if (acpi_get_parent(handle, &phandle))
+               return -ENODEV;
+
+        if ((ACPI_SUCCESS(acpi_get_handle(phandle, "_GTF", &tmp))) ||
+                (ACPI_SUCCESS(acpi_get_handle(phandle, "_GTM", &tmp))) ||
+                (ACPI_SUCCESS(acpi_get_handle(phandle, "_STM", &tmp))) ||
+                (ACPI_SUCCESS(acpi_get_handle(phandle, "_SDD", &tmp))))
+                return 0;
+
+       return -ENODEV;
+}
